VK2AAA Rating: 2012-01-19
Needs modding IMHO Time Owned: 0 to 3 months.
I bought one of these based on the reviews and it was readily available here in Oz. I have to say I was pretty disappointed - the bass is hollow and boomy sounding to my ears. I played with the filters which improved it but in the end took it apart and stuffed it with batting - polyester stuff that goes inside cushions, pillows etc. Much better now.

K2PJW Rating: 2010-11-07
Nice Speaker Time Owned: 0 to 3 months.
I have had issues with the speakers in my radios sounding tinny, hollow, etc. I have searched high and low for a solution. Finally , I found what I was looking for. The SP-2000 is the answer for me. The filter settings are a great feature and in addition to the settings in the radio equipment, you can nicely tailor any mode. I enjoy AM dx'ing and swl'ing, in addition to my regular ham activities. This speaker makes listening to any of these modes relaxing and fun. I bought this speaker to compliment my FT-950 and it did. I hooked up my little FT-450 to the speaker and what a difference, as the FT-450 stock speaker sounds like crap IMHO.

The price on these great speakers varies considerably from dealer to dealer. Be sure to look around.

From someone who is picky about their receive audio, I highly recommend this speaker.

BG4TRF Rating: 2009-05-29
Amazing Time Owned: 0 to 3 months.
Good for money though it cost me 190USD.

I've owned it for 6 weeks and it is just AMAZING.
MADE IN JAPAN and well built, big box and light weight. The height is designed for ft-2000 and looks a bit bigger sitting near my ft-950. The feet are able to be elevated as your transceiver for a perfect match.

Buildin filters likes low cut would beat the noise on SSB and high cut is very efficient for high frequency CW QRM. working great.

Selectable 2 input for 2 RIGs and one button instant mute are very handy.

The pity is only 1 supplied audio link cable. It's pretty difficult to find that kind of mono cable for me.
